AEON Raises $8 Million Led by YZi Labs, Accelerating Standardization of AI Agent Payment Infrastructure
AEON, a developer of a dedicated payment and settlement layer for AI agents, has raised $8 million from YZi Labs. The funds will be used to enhance infrastructure that supports autonomous commerce between AI agents without human intervention.
On May 18, 2026, AEON announced that it secured $8 million in a funding round led by YZi Labs. This investment aims to address payment and settlement systems, which are key bottlenecks for interactions between AI agents within the rapidly growing Agentic Economy.
AEON plans to use the secured funds to finalize the settlement layer designed for Agent-to-Agent (A2A) interactions. Lead investor YZi Labs made the strategic investment decision, believing that the infrastructure AEON is building will become the foundation of the future AI economy. This layer focuses on providing an environment where AI models can autonomously perform and settle transactions.
"The agentic economy is reshaping how businesses monetize AI workloads, but traditional payment processors like Stripe were not designed for autonomous agents."
Existing payment systems are designed based on the premise of human approval and intervention, failing to meet the requirements of AI agents that operate autonomously 24/7. For AI agents to act as economic entities, verifiable transaction authorization and a stable settlement system within a trusted network are essential. AEON is taking a blockchain-native approach to bridge this infrastructure gap.
Technical Architecture: x402 and ERC-8004 Standards
AEON supports new standards such as x402 and ERC-8004, granting AI agents verifiable identity and transaction authority. In particular, through the 'Agentic Encryption' framework, it enables AI models to make autonomous decisions within policy boundaries even in an encrypted state and coordinate across untrusted networks. The table below summarizes the detailed functions of the key technical standards adopted by AEON.
- x402: A stablecoin settlement standard that enables native A2A (Agent-to-Agent) payments without human intervention.
- ERC-8004: A verifiable identity framework that grants transaction authority to autonomous agents.
- Agentic Encryption: Allows models to reason over encrypted data and make autonomous decisions within policy boundaries.
AEON has already demonstrated the effectiveness of its settlement layer, recording over $29 million in AI payment throughput. This achievement suggests that AI-based commerce is moving beyond a theoretical stage into actual economic activity. A verifiable and stable 24/7 payment infrastructure is considered a key element supporting the sustainability of the agent economy.

Competitive Landscape of Agentic Commerce
As of 2026, AI platforms account for approximately $20.9 billion in retail spending, representing 1.5% of the total market. 'Agentic commerce'—where agents such as ChatGPT, Perplexity, and Gemini compare products and execute payments on behalf of users—is becoming a full-fledged trend. Moving forward, AEON intends to focus on expanding merchant protocol adoption and ensuring transparent payment flows across multiple networks. Amidst competition and collaboration with commerce protocols proposed by Google or the OpenAI-Stripe alliance, expanding the settlement layer through open standards will be key to market establishment. As autonomous financial activities become more common, the role of stable infrastructure is expected to become even more critical.
